PETROLEUM (ONSHORE) ACT 1991 - SECT 106F

Application for review of assessed deposit

106F Application for review of assessed deposit

(1) The holder of a petroleum title may apply for a review by the Minister of the Secretary's assessment of the amount of the security deposit that may be required for the petroleum title.
(2) The application must--
(a) be made in writing, and
(b) be made in a form approved by the Minister (if any form is approved), and
(c) contain particulars of the grounds for review of the assessment, and
(d) contain or be accompanied by such other information or documents as the Minister requires to review the assessment (which requirement may be specified on the Department's website), and
(e) be accompanied by any fee required by the regulations, and
(f) be lodged with the Secretary within 28 days after notice is given to the holder of the petroleum title of the assessment or within such other period as the regulations may prescribe.
(3) The holder of a petroleum title is not entitled to apply for a review under this section if the assessment concerned has previously been reviewed under this section.
(4) This section applies in respect of a revision of an assessment in the same way as it applies in respect of an assessment.
